News

News refers to information or reports about recent events, developments, or happenings that are of interest to the public. This information can cover various topics, including politics, economics, health, science, technology, sports, culture, and international affairs. News can be disseminated through various mediums, including newspapers, television, radio, and online platforms. The primary purpose of news is to inform people about important occurrences in their world, enabling them to stay updated and make informed decisions. News typically adheres to standards of accuracy, timeliness, and objectivity, though the quality and bias can vary significantly between different news sources. The collection and reporting of news involve journalistic practices, including investigation, interviewing, and verifying facts.
